Q: How should Ferric Chloride be stored for maximum shelf life?

A: Ferric Chloride should be stored in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area away from moisture. Proper storage in sealed plastic drums, bags, or IBC tanks preserves its stability and ensures a shelf life of up to 2 years from manufacturing.

Q: What are the primary applications of Ferric Chloride?

A: Ferric Chloride is chiefly used as a coagulant in industrial and municipal water treatment, as well as for printed circuit board etching and sewage treatment, thanks to its remarkable capability to remove impurities and contaminants.

Q: When is Ferric Chloride considered the optimal choice in water treatment processes?

A: Ferric Chloride is ideal for water and wastewater treatment when high-efficiency coagulation is required to remove suspended solids, organic matter, and phosphorus, ensuring treated water meets regulatory standards.
